Introduction Hidden Charges



Discovering covert charges is essential when preparing for a roof installation job. These stealthy added costs can considerably influence your budget otherwise accounted for upfront.

One common surprise charge to look out for is the cost of permits. Depending upon your area, allows may be needed for the installation of a brand-new roofing system, and the charges can vary. It's crucial to factor these expenditures into your general budget to avoid any shocks.


One more surprise price that commonly catches home owners off-guard is the demand for roofing repairs found throughout the installation procedure. If the roofer finds underlying concerns such as water damage or architectural worries, the necessary repairs can include unanticipated prices to your job. To avoid these surprises, think about obtaining a complete inspection before starting the setup.

In addition, disposal costs for old roofing products can sometimes be forgotten. The cost of getting rid of and throwing away the old roof covering can differ based on the size of your roof covering and the products being replaced. By anticipating these prospective covert costs, you can better plan for an effective and cost-effective roof covering setup job.
